Four arrested on suspicion of drugs supply following warrant at property in Southport

We have arrested four males after a warrant was executed at a property in Southport today, Tuesday 10th September.

At 9.40am officers attended at the property in Bath Street. The four males, aged 18, 19, 20 and 22, were arrested on suspicion of possession with intent to supply cannabis and are currently in custody where they will be questioned by officers.

During a search of the property we recovered 70 small bags of cannabis, eight large bags of cannabis, £2000 in cash, scales, mobile phones and shotgun cartridges.
